CREATE EXTERNAL TABLE в улье работает успешно, но дает нулевые результаты - PullRequest
0 голосов
/ 31 августа 2018

Когда я выполняю CREATE EXTERNAL TABLE в улье, он запускается успешно, но дает ноль результатов. Я использую:

ROW FORMAT DELIMITED FIELDS TERMINATED BY ',' stored as textfile
LOCATION '/common_folder/nyc_taxi_data/'
tblproperties ("skip.header.line.count"="2");

, где данные приведены в nyc_taxi_data. Это создает только представление без данных?

Ответы [ 2 ]

0 голосов
/ 14 сентября 2018

Предполагая, что файл, из которого данные загружаются в таблицу, является "nyc_taxi_data", используйте LOCATION '/ common_folder / nyc_taxi_data' Если «nyc_taxi_data» является родительской папкой, используйте LOCATION '/ common_folder / nyc_taxi_data / name_of_the_text_file'

0 голосов
/ 02 сентября 2018

Используйте LOCATION '/ common_folder / nyc_taxi_data' вместо МЕСТО '/ common_folder / nyc_taxi_data /' в вашем DDL.

Если вы уже загрузили данные в формате hdf, выполните тестирование с помощью запроса выбора.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...